Per CalgaryFlames.com:

"Foo, a native of Edmonton, Alberta, just completed his junior year at Union College where he put up 26 goals and 36 assists for 62 points in 38 games and was a finalist for the 2016-17 Hobey Baker Memorial Award. He topped the 100 career points mark this season and had a program-record 21-game point streak in addition to tying for the ECAC scoring title; while leading the league in assists (25), multi-point games (14) and plus-minus (+20)."

Via CalgaryFlames.com:

"“First of all, it’s an absolute blessing to be in the position I am,” conceded the Union Dutchmen right winger, after making a much-awaited decision on his NHL organization of choice.“It’s tough comparing teams.“I know it’s most kids’ dreams to play for their hometown team, the one they grew up cheering for. That was certainly a consideration with me. All four of the organizations I was talked to at the end were great, great people, top to bottom. That made this really difficult.“But in the end, I thought the best fit for me was Calgary.”"
